About Project

This project strengthens Indonesia’s preparedness and response to avian influenza, a national priority zoonotic disease with high transmission risk in Java. With increasing poultry production and movement, the program enhances Early Detection, Notification, and Rapid Response systems by reinforcing Emergency Media and Community Engagement (EMCE) capacity within the Ministry of Health.

The project develops a pre-positioned, audience-tailored EMCE messaging toolkit for rapid deployment during outbreaks. It includes audience segmentation, evidence-based messaging frameworks, digital communication materials, and orientation for MoH working groups and local champions.

The approach can be adapted for other zoonotic diseases to strengthen overall outbreak preparedness.
